In this subtitle: The term Administration means the Transportation Security Administration. The term Administrator means the Administrator of the Transportation Security Administration. The term appropriate committees of Congress means— the Committee on Commerce, Science, and Transportation of the Senate ; the Committee on Homeland Security and Governmental Affairs of the Senate; and the Committee on Homeland Security of the House of Representatives . The term ASAC means the Aviation Security Advisory Committee established under section 44946 of title 49, United States Code.
The term Secretary means the Secretary of Homeland Security. The term SIDA means Secure Identification Display Area as defined in section 1540.5 of title 49, Code of Federal Regulations, or any successor regulation to such section.
